The Role

We have an exciting opportunity for a Building & Grounds Maintenance Operative to join our friendly team. This is a hands-on role where you'll travel to various sites across the South West, carrying out essential maintenance activities to support our Drinking Water Services operations. During the spring, summer, and early autumn, your focus will primarily be on grounds maintenance. Outside of the growing season, you'll also support a range of building maintenance tasks, all under the guidance of the Building & Grounds Maintenance Team Leader.

Key Responsibilities

  • Carry out reactive and planned maintenance across South West Water assets
  • Grounds maintenance activities including:
    • Grass cutting and strimming
    • Hedge trimming
    • Tree work (ground level)
    • Path repairs and maintenance (gravel, concrete, slabs, steps)
    • Use of powered plant, hand tools, and chemicals
  • Perform general building maintenance, including:
    • Woodwork and door repairs
    • Roof gutter maintenance
    • Painting and decorating
  • Provide accurate and timely updates on completed work
  • Follow schedules, procedures, and business rules
  • Liaise with the Team Leader and Central Support Administrator to optimise workloads
  • Respond to customer enquiries professionally when required
  • Ensure all work is conducted in line with Health & Safety regulations and safe systems of work
  • Support periodic maintenance activities such as chemical tank cleaning
